En Vivo! album for sale by Iron Maiden was released Mar 26, 2012 on the Sanctuary label. Hearing Iron Maiden fans sing along to a new song like "El Dorodo" with the same ferocity that's applied to classic cuts like "Number of the Beast," "Two Minutes to Midnight," and "Hallowed Be Thy Name" must be invigorating for a group that has toured and recorded steadily for almost 40 years and never had a proper hit, let alone a commercial radio presence.2010's Final Frontier (their 15th studio album), while by no means earth shattering, offered up further proof that the venerable New Wave of British Heavy Metal practitioners were unwilling to spend their twilight years clinging to the commercial safety of past glories.2012's En Vivo! (their tenth live album), which was recorded in Santiago, Chile's Estadio Nacional Julio Martínez Prádanos stadium during the Final Frontier tour, finds Iron Maiden solidly straddling the line between both eras, offering up equal servings of material both new and old, and integrating them seamlessly into each other, just they like they always do. ~ James Christopher Monger Director: Andy Matthews.   ...See Full Description

En Vivo! album for sale Most people think of the legendary Ronnie James Dio as one of heavy metal's sage elder statesmen, but when his newly minted namesake band performed at the 1983 Castle Donington Monsters of Rock Festival, fresh off the release of their soon-to-be seminal debut album, Holy Diver, they behaved like fresh-faced upstarts with everything to prove. Don't believe it? Well then, consider the fact that, despite his already enviable track record at the helm of Elf, Rainbow, and Black Sabbath, on that hot August day, Dio and his charges found themselves crammed fifth on the bill, warming up the crowd for Whitesnake, Meat Loaf, ZZ Top, and Twisted Sister! But, as you'd expect from the indefatigable vocalist (already 41-years-old that day!), his professional standards never fell short of headlining status as he guided his handpicked bandmembers -- faithful Sabbath partner, drummer Vinnie Appice, former Rainbow associate, bassist Jimmy Bain, and white-hot guitar prodigy Vivian Campbell -- through an energized set of past and future heavy metal classics. With only 45 minutes allotted to them, the band blazed through the newer Dio cuts ("Stand Up and Shout," "Rainbow in the Dark," "Holy Diver") in the concert's first half before embarking on a medley of established fan favorites combining portions of "Stargazer," "Starstruck," "Man on the Silver Mountain" (all Rainbow standards), and the Sabs' "Heaven and Hell," which, when stretched out to include an audience participation section, nearly brought down the ol' Castle. Final verdict: all killer, no filler. Four years later, Dio were invited back to Donington, sans Campbell (recently replaced by Craig Goldy), but tellingly slotted second only to headliners Bon Jovi on a bill also featuring -- get this: Metallica, Anthrax, W.A.S.P., and Cinderella -- a testament to the group's great success during in the intervening years. But, in contrast to this, Dio's performance felt a little less inspired and spontaneous (more like clockwork than hungry to please) due to the many years they'd spent grinding it out on tour -- not to mention churning out steadily diluted original material like "Dream Evil," "Rock and Roll Children," and "Naked in the Rain" (remember that one? Neither do we). "The Last in Line," at least, still held sway with magnificent gravitas, and, as always, the Rainbow and Sabbath nuggets were interspersed amid these cuts, oftentimes in truncated form, making for alternately confusing and entertaining combinations that ultimately sent the punters home happy. Now, decades on, these two landmark performances finally see the light of day as the first release issued by Dio's own Niji Entertainment Group, but, tragically, the double-disc set arrived just a few months after the great singer's passing following a short but typically spirited battle against stomach cancer. Nevertheless, Dio's music will obviously live on forever. ~ Eduardo Rivadavia Recording information: Total Access Studios, Redondo Beach, CA. Photographers: P.G. En Vivo! songs Megadeth's 13th studio album, and first since 2001's The World Needs a Hero to utilize the talents of bassist/founding member Dave Ellefson, was produced by Johnny K (Staind, Disturbed) and features a combination of newly composed tracks, along with older cuts written years ago but never put to tape. Darker, heavier, and more immediate than 2009's Endgame, Dave Mustaine's snarling vocals ride higher in the mix this time around, but fans need not fear, as his fleet fingers are still possessed with the power to conjure the dead. Much of the aptly named Th1rt3en feels vintage, from the familiar political themes on "We the People" and the tightly wound, Dio-esque riffing on "Public Enemy No. 1" to the soft, melodramatic military snare intro of "Never Dead," which eventually explodes into a wicked blast of retro-thrash that feels positively invigorating, not redundant. Elsewhere, the melodic slow-burn "Millennium of the Blind" fuses Ten Years After's "I'd Love to Change the World" and Metallica's "Fade to Black" into an anti-corporation/war rant that calls out the "millennials" on their submissiveness, the snaky "Black Swan" casts long shadows that mimic "Symphony of Destruction," and first single "Sudden Death" stands defiant before the skeptics who thought that Mustaine's newfound faith would render him bereft of the old ultraviolence. ~ James Christopher Monger Recording information: Mustaine Music Studios, San Marcos, CA. En Vivo! album for sale The idea behind FLIGHT 666 was seemingly birthed from a WAYNE'S WORLD fantasy sequence: the mighty Iron Maiden would embark upon a world tour of exotic locales, transported to each venue in a custom 757 jet piloted by the band's lead singer, with scores of crew, journalists, and family members in tow. Surprisingly, the band not only pulled off the mind-boggling undertaking but delivered an extraordinary live album in the process. The FLIGHT 666 soundtrack compares favorably with the band's classic in-concert disc, LIVE AFTER DEATH, and, since it is heavy on classic Maiden tracks like "Run to the Hills" and "The Trooper," would also serve as a fine introduction for newbies. Throughout, the band's performances are spirited and joyous, showing that Iron Maiden were still the kings of British metal more than three decades into their storied career. Photographer: John McMurtrie. From Fear to Eternity: The Best of 1990-2010 collects 23 tracks over the span of two discs from the venerable British heavy metal legends. The first anthology to cover the band's post-halcyon days, it's remarkable how seamless the transition was. Unlike other acts that left their handprints in the cement in the late '70s and '80s, Iron Maiden never really lost steam, despite a mid-'90s shake-up that saw iconic lead singer Bruce Dickinson swapped out with Wolfsbane vocalist Blaze Bayley for two albums. The addition of keyboards, a controversial, late-'80s move that split some fans upon the releases of Somewhere in Time (1986) and Seventh Son of a Seventh Son (1988), proved largely tasteful and subtle, and did little to hinder their signature blend of fantasy-fueled symphonic metal and straight-up English hard rock. Culled from eight studio albums (including the pair of Bayley offerings), the songs on From Fear to Eternity may not reach the dizzying heights of the band's Piece of Mind/Number of the Beast heyday, but stand-out cuts like "The Wicker Man," "Different World," "Tailgunner," "Dance of Death," and "Brave New World" bristle with the energy and conviction of a group 20 years younger. Dickinson's voice is apparently indestructible, and the triple-guitar attack, held down to the mat by the incomparable Steve Harris (founder/bassist), remains a veritable master class in heavy metal picking. It's an impressive feat, to say the least, but what stands out the most is the fact the band has amassed the kind of loyal, age-defying fan base that virtually guarantees a lifetime of sold-out world tours, a feat they managed to pull off without ever selling themselves out. ~ James Christopher Monger Personnel: Bruce Dickinson (vocals); Dave Murray , Janick Gers, Adrian Smith (guitar); Steve Harris (keyboards); Nicko McBrain (drums).
